Transaction 6f610389336d03f9be83fc0a57c98dc80de770d37db59c13df626404815446b9

1 Input
2 Outputs
  • 6f610389336d03f9be83fc0a57c98dc80de770d37db59c13df626404815446b9:0
  • value  2021160
    address  1DxEMorreEJYAaPDp86UcZUa9qf61trtgk
  • 6f610389336d03f9be83fc0a57c98dc80de770d37db59c13df626404815446b9:1
  • value  6690495
    address  1HgbzDiQ5ExDEVQMHivWCisbmu5msFj67d